I just got my new smart trainer, that beast of the Drivo ! :-)

But I noticed that the power measured is "way" off, the Drivo underestimates the power I put by about 25-30W. So when I put 250W, the Drivo will only report about 220-225W. This is compared to my Stages powermeter, as well as my previous Trainer (Tacx Vortex): those two PM are very close from one another - once the Vortex has been warmed-up. One could say that the Drivo is the one giving the real numbers, and that the two other are giving wrong values; but I really can feel (in my legs !) that the power is off by a large margin, because I'm using virtual reality applications which simulate real roads, and I can tell you that the feeling is not correct on the Drivo, it's way too hard !

So I'd like to know if there is a way to calibrate it, or if I should return the unit before the Winter indoor season :'-( begins ?

Hi

I think there has been a misunderstanding on this topic.
It is self calibrating in the sense that it doesn't need an external power sensor (as it has its own).
But you need to give it the command to calibrate.
